MoneyCone is one man’s experience with… well, money! Saving and spending money should be a simple concept. Yet, an average American has over $15,000 in credit card debt alone and our national savings rate is at an all time low. The money masters don’t make this any easier either. The more confused you are, the more money they can make. This is called stupidity tax. Shopping for a home? Know what’s the difference between an interest rate and an APY? Why do credit cards use APR and not APY? Is there a difference? These are some basic questions that everyone should be aware of. Yet, most don’t and happily fork over their hard earned money. This blog came out of frustration and having gotten tired of paying stupidity taxes. I decided to learn as much as I can about finance. Most of my posts are short and to the point – in the form of HOWTOs. That way you won’t have to spend as much time I spend on grasping financial concepts! This blog is a running journal of what I’ve learnt…
